Tips Amazon api tutorial

giahung214

New member
[TIẾNG VIỆT]:
** Hướng dẫn API Amazon: Cách bắt đầu **

Amazon Web Services (AWS) cung cấp một loạt các API mà bạn có thể sử dụng để truy cập các dịch vụ của mình.Trong hướng dẫn này, chúng tôi sẽ chỉ cho bạn cách bắt đầu với cổng API Amazon.Gateway API là một dịch vụ được quản lý đầy đủ cho phép bạn tạo, xuất bản và quản lý API.

## Bước 1: Tạo tài khoản Gateway API Amazon

Để bắt đầu với Cổng API, bạn sẽ cần tạo một tài khoản dịch vụ web Amazon.Bạn có thể làm điều này bằng cách truy cập [trang web AWS] (Cloud Computing Services - Amazon Web Services (AWS)) và nhấp vào nút ** Tạo tài khoản AWS **.

Khi bạn đã tạo một tài khoản AWS, bạn sẽ cần phải đăng nhập vào [Bảng điều khiển quản lý AWS] (https://console.aws.amazon.com/).

## Bước 2: Tạo dự án API Gateway

Khi bạn đã đăng nhập vào bảng điều khiển quản lý AWS, bạn sẽ cần tạo dự án API Gateway.Để làm điều này, nhấp vào menu ** Dịch vụ ** và chọn ** Gateway API **.

Trên trang ** API Gateway **, nhấp vào nút ** Tạo API **.

Trong hộp thoại ** Tạo API **, nhập tên cho API của bạn và chọn tùy chọn API ** REST **.

Nhấp vào nút ** Tạo ** để tạo API của bạn.

## Bước 3: Tạo tài nguyên API

Bây giờ bạn đã tạo API, bạn cần tạo tài nguyên API.Tài nguyên API là một nhóm các phương thức hợp lý thực hiện một nhiệm vụ cụ thể.

Để tạo tài nguyên API, nhấp vào tab ** Tài nguyên ** và nhấp vào nút ** Tạo tài nguyên **.

Trong hộp thoại ** Tạo tài nguyên **, nhập tên cho tài nguyên của bạn và chọn phương thức ** get **.

Nhấp vào nút ** Tạo ** để tạo tài nguyên của bạn.

## Bước 4: Tạo phương thức API

Bây giờ bạn đã tạo một tài nguyên API, bạn cần tạo phương thức API.Phương thức API là một hoạt động cụ thể có thể được thực hiện trên tài nguyên API.

Để tạo phương thức API, nhấp vào tab ** Phương thức ** và nhấp vào nút ** Tạo phương thức **.

Trong hộp thoại ** Tạo phương thức **, chọn phương thức ** GET ** và nhập một đường dẫn cho phương thức của bạn.

Nhấp vào nút ** Tạo ** để tạo phương thức của bạn.

## Bước 5: Thực hiện phương thức API của bạn

Bây giờ bạn đã tạo một phương thức API, bạn cần thực hiện nó.Để làm điều này, bạn sẽ cần phải viết một mã sẽ xử lý yêu cầu và trả lại phản hồi.

Đối với hướng dẫn này, chúng tôi sẽ đơn giản trả lại một phản hồi được mã hóa cứng.

Để thực hiện phương thức API của bạn, nhấp vào tab ** mã ** và nhấp vào nút ** Chỉnh sửa **.

Trong mã ** Bộ chỉnh sửa **, thay thế mã sau:

`` `
// Nhận cơ thể yêu cầu
var body = request.body;

// Trả lại phản hồi mã hóa cứng
trở lại {
Mã trạng thái: 200,
Body: Json.Stringify ({
Tin nhắn: "Xin chào Thế giới!"
})
};
`` `

## Bước 6: Kiểm tra API của bạn

Bây giờ bạn đã thực hiện phương thức API của mình, bạn cần kiểm tra nó.Để làm điều này, bạn có thể sử dụng [Bảng điều khiển cổng API API] (https://console.aws.amazon.com/apigeway/).

Trong bảng điều khiển Cổng API AWS, nhấp vào tab ** test ** và nhấp vào nút ** Gọi **.

Trong hộp thoại ** Gọi **, hãy nhập đường dẫn đến phương thức của bạn và nhấp vào nút ** Gọi **.

Bạn sẽ thấy một phản hồi tương tự như sau:

`` `
{
"StatusCode": 200,
"Body": "{\" message \ ": \" Hello World! \ "}"
}
`` `

## Bước 7: Triển khai API của bạn

Bây giờ bạn đã kiểm tra API của mình, bạn cần triển khai nó.Để thực hiện việc này, nhấp vào menu ** hành động ** và chọn ** triển khai API **.

Trong hộp thoại ** Triển khai API **, hãy nhập tên để triển khai của bạn và nhấp vào nút ** Triển khai **.

API của bạn hiện đã được triển khai và có thể được truy cập bằng cách sử dụng URL

[ENGLISH]:
**Amazon API Tutorial: How to Get Started**

Amazon Web Services (AWS) offers a wide range of APIs that you can use to access its services. In this tutorial, we will show you how to get started with the Amazon API Gateway. The API Gateway is a fully managed service that allows you to create, publish, and manage APIs.

## Step 1: Create an Amazon API Gateway account

To get started with the API Gateway, you will need to create an Amazon Web Services account. You can do this by visiting the [AWS website](https://aws.amazon.com/) and clicking on the **Create an AWS account** button.

Once you have created an AWS account, you will need to sign in to the [AWS Management Console](https://console.aws.amazon.com/).

## Step 2: Create an API Gateway project

Once you are logged in to the AWS Management Console, you will need to create an API Gateway project. To do this, click on the **Services** menu and select **API Gateway**.

On the **API Gateway** page, click on the **Create API** button.

In the **Create API** dialog box, enter a name for your API and select the **REST API** option.

Click on the **Create** button to create your API.

## Step 3: Create an API resource

Now that you have created an API, you need to create an API resource. An API resource is a logical grouping of methods that perform a specific task.

To create an API resource, click on the **Resources** tab and click on the **Create Resource** button.

In the **Create Resource** dialog box, enter a name for your resource and select the **GET** method.

Click on the **Create** button to create your resource.

## Step 4: Create an API method

Now that you have created an API resource, you need to create an API method. An API method is a specific operation that can be performed on an API resource.

To create an API method, click on the **Methods** tab and click on the **Create Method** button.

In the **Create Method** dialog box, select the **GET** method and enter a path for your method.

Click on the **Create** button to create your method.

## Step 5: Implement your API method

Now that you have created an API method, you need to implement it. To do this, you will need to write a code that will handle the request and return a response.

For this tutorial, we will simply return a hardcoded response.

To implement your API method, click on the **Code** tab and click on the **Edit** button.

In the **Code** editor, replace the following code:

```
// Get the request body
var body = request.body;

// Return a hardcoded response
return {
statusCode: 200,
body: JSON.stringify({
message: "Hello World!"
})
};
```

## Step 6: Test your API

Now that you have implemented your API method, you need to test it. To do this, you can use the [AWS API Gateway Console](https://console.aws.amazon.com/apigateway/).

In the AWS API Gateway Console, click on the **Test** tab and click on the **Invoke** button.

In the **Invoke** dialog box, enter the path to your method and click on the **Invoke** button.

You should see a response similar to the following:

```
{
"statusCode": 200,
"body": "{\"message\":\"Hello World!\"}"
}
```

## Step 7: Deploy your API

Now that you have tested your API, you need to deploy it. To do this, click on the **Actions** menu and select **Deploy API**.

In the **Deploy API** dialog box, enter a name for your deployment and click on the **Deploy** button.

Your API is now deployed and can be accessed by using the URL that
 
Join Telegram ToolsKiemTrieuDoGroup
Back
Top